St. Mary's Parish School - Secondary

St. Mary's Parish School–Secondary in Wefield, MA, is a Catholic co–ed private school serving grades 9 through 12 in a suburban community.
The school enrolls 103 udents with a student–teacher ratio of 9:1 supported by 11 teachers.
udents of color represent 3.1% of the total enrollment at this suburban secondary school.
This Wefield Catholic high school provides education within a community of nearby private schools serving various grade spans and enrollment sizes.

Did You Know?

The average private school tuition in Massachusetts is $24,786 for elementary schools and $40,812 for high schools (read more about average private school tuition across the country).
The average acceptance rate in Massachusetts is 71% (read more about average acceptance rates across the country).
